At St. Jude School, our international school in San José, your child's learning and personal growth are at the heart of everything we do.
Our admissions process is simple, personalized, and attentive to your family's needs, with multilingual support available for international families.

Academic excellence
Reach bilingual excellence reflected in MAP (NWEA) scores beyond global benchmarks and a 98% success rate for admission to universities in Costa Rica, the US, and Europe.
National and IB pathways
Earn international accreditations at every level, including National Baccalaureate and International Baccalaureate through rigorous, globally recognized pathways.
Visible progress every day
Track clear progress in English, Math, and Science through personalized teaching and ISP Lab tools, building curiosity, confidence, and a visible love of learning.
Individualized support
Follow a unique journey with tailored programs such as CASE V for high-performance athletes and LEAP for gifted learners, supported by small classes that provide the right stretch and care.
Multilingual learning
Develop strong multilingual skills in English and Spanish, study French from Preschool to Secondary, and graduate from the IBDP with a bilingual diploma and global opportunities.
Nurturing learning environment
Experience balanced, joy-filled classrooms that grow intellect and heart, practicing empathy, collaboration, and resilience while growing confidence to lead with kindness.

At St.Jude school, students enjoy a personalized learning process that adapts and evolves according to their unique needs and talents.
Ages 6 months - 6 years
Step into learning from your very first day. You explore, play and discover with the International Early Years Curriculum (IEYC) as your guide. Every moment sparks curiosity and helps you grow in ways that matter now and for the future.
Ages 6 - 11
Take charge of your learning journey. Ask questions, try new things and build skills in a lively, supportive space. Expert teachers challenge and encourage you as you explore, create and connect with others every day.
Ages 11 - 18
Grow your confidence and shape your future. Dive into the International Middle Years Curriculum (IMYC), join special activities and push boundaries. Every experience helps you think bigger, care deeper and lead with purpose.
Ages 16 - 18
Own your ambitions and prepare for what comes next. Tackle the International Baccalaureate (IB) Diploma Programme, sharpen your thinking and expand your world view. Get ready for university and life beyond, with skills that set you apart.
Start your child's educational journey with confidence. Submit your application and get ready for an exciting beginning to their school life.
Contact us today
Contact our admissions team or fill out the inquiry form to express your interest and ask any initial questions.
Schedule a tour
Book a tour to visit our private school, meet our staff, and experience our dynamic learning environment. You can also join our online information sessions.
Application submission
Submit the application form along with the required documents, including previous school reports and any relevant information about your child.
Assessment and interview
An academic assessment and/or interview will be scheduled with our academic team to ensure we can fully support your child's individual needs.
Offer and Admission
Selected candidates will receive an official offer. Families confirm admission by signing the enrollment contract and paying the corresponding fees.
Welcome to St. Jude School
Before the first day of school, families will receive essential information to ensure a smooth transition, including details about uniforms, timetables, and orientation.
